About Cranbourne West 3977

The size of Cranbourne West is approximately 11.8 square kilometres. It has 23 parks covering nearly 10.1% of total area. The population of Cranbourne West in 2016 was 15035 people. By 2021 the population was 19969 showing a population growth of 32.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cranbourne West is 30-39 years. Households in Cranbourne West are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cranbourne West work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 74.30% of the homes in Cranbourne West were owner-occupied compared with 76.00% in 2016.

Cranbourne West has 9,394 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Cranbourne West have seen a 37.03%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 33.68% increase. As at 31 December 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Cranbourne West is $779,606 while the median value for Units is $576,500.
  • Houses have a median rent of $585 while Units have a median rent of $510.
